error execution phase check-etcd: etcd cluster is not healthy: failed to dial endpoint with maintenance client: context deadline exceeded

Check etcd related pods

kubectl get pod -n kube-system

enter into 

kubectl exec -ti etcd-k8s-master01 -n kube-system sh
export ETCDCTL_API=3
etcdctl --cacert="/etc/kubernetes/pki/etcd/ca.crt" --cert="/etc/kubernetes/pki/etcd/server.crt" --key="/etc/kubernetes/pki/etcd/server.key" member list

found the following information

Remove the problematic k8s-master03 node

etcdctl --cacert="/etc/kubernetes/pki/etcd/ca.crt" --cert="/etc/kubernetes/pki/etcd/server.crt" --key="/etc/kubernetes/pki/etcd/server.key" member remove 17826e460c060952

Then re-execute the node join command, it shows success

